1. Eligibility Check
To request a driver's license in Austria, you need to fulfill the following requirements:
- Be at least the minimum age for the wanted license category.
- Have a legitimate residency authorization if you are not an EU/EEA citizen.
- Be clinically fit to drive, validated through a health evaluation.
2. Enlist in Driving School
For a lot of classifications, registering in an acknowledged driving school is obligatory. In the driving school, you'll discover traffic rules, safe driving practices, and take both theoretical and practical lessons.
3. Theory Test
After completing the needed theoretical lessons, you'll require to pass a theory test, which includes multiple-choice questions based upon Austrian traffic laws and indications. This test can be taken in a number of languages.
4. Practical Driving Lessons
When you pass the theory test, you will need to finish practical driving lessons. Each classification requires a particular number of driving hours, where you will discover defensive driving and the skills needed for the roadway.

After completing the necessary lessons, you will be qualified for the useful driving test. Österreichischen Führerschein Erwerben involves demonstrating your capability to operate a vehicle securely and follow all traffic laws. The test is carried out by a main examiner.
6. Application Submission
Upon passing both the theoretical and practical tests, you can send your application for a driver's license. The documents needed typically include:
- A completed application kind
- Evidence of identity and residency
- Medical fitness certificate
- Certificates proving conclusion of driving lessons
- A passport-sized photo
7. File Verification and Payment
Your application will be processed by the local driver's licensing authority. There is usually a fee involved, which can vary by area and license category. It's suggested to inspect the regional authority's website for the particular cost structure.
8. Issuance of License
As soon as your application is approved, you will get your Austrian driver's license. The standard license stands for 15 years, after which it requires to be renewed.

1. Can I drive in Austria with a foreign driver's license?
Yes, individuals from the EU/EEA can drive with their foreign licenses. However, non-EU nationals may need an International Driving Permit (IDP) together with their home nation license for approximately six months.
2. How long does it take to get an Austrian driver's license?
The timeline can vary significantly depending on the driving school, individual schedule for lessons, and how rapidly you can schedule your tests. On average, it may take three to 6 months.
3. What happens if I fail the theory or useful test?
You can retake the theory test after a waiting period of at least two weeks, while useful tests can usually be retaken after a month. Each retake might involve extra fees.
4. Exist any age constraints for driving school registration?
Yes, you should be at least 17 years old to register in a driving school in Austria.
5. Exists a different procedure for obtaining a license for motorbikes or trucks?
Yes, each lorry classification has its own requirements for tests, lessons, and eligibility that you should follow.
